Plasmids encoding a signal guide RNA are designed to insert a point mutation in exon 4 of the gene. Exon 4 was modified to harbor a tyrosine to cytosine substitution at amino acid 198 (C198R), which corresponds to a C203R mutation commonly found in patients with Blue Cone Monochromacy. (J:101977)
